Annual Meeting Call for Proposals
Deadline: February 4, 2004

The Mid-Atlantic Association of Museums (MAAM) and the Pennsylvania
Federation of Museums (PFMHO) will host a joint annual meeting in
Philadelphia, PA on October 16-19, 2004.

Your professional expertise is needed now! Develop a program session for the
MAAM/PFMHO 2004 annual meeting and receive a FREE one-year MAAM membership!
All non-member presenters on sessions accepted by the MAAM/PFMHO Program
Committee will be provided a complimentary one-year membership in the
Mid-Atlantic Association of Museums beginning in June 2004.

*** Art Museums and the Public Trust ***
Recommended Reading for 2004:
Whose Muse? Art Museums and the Public Trust
Edited by James Cuno, Director, Courtauld Institute of Art, London.
Published by Princeton University Press, this new book features articles by
five of the leading US/British art museum directors, including:

- Phillipe de Montebello, Director,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York
- Glenn D. Lowry, Director, Museum of Modern Art, New York
- Neil MacGregor, Director, British Museum, London
- John Walsh, Director Emeritus, J. Paul Getty Museum, Los Angeles
- James Wood, Director, Art Institute of Chicago

Anne d'Harnoncourt, Director, Philadelphia Museum of Art also participated
in the roundtable discussion documented in this book. MAAM members can
